Literacy Texas
Literacy Texas is the statewide literacy coalition for Texas, connecting and equipping literacy programs through resources, training, networking, and advocacy. It provides leadership to help community-based organizations that provide literacy services, literacy coalitions, and adult education program throughout the state build capacity and improve literacy levels in Texas. Literacy Texas maintains a list of Texas literacy coalitions, which can be seen on their website.
Literacy Powerline
Literacy Powerline’s mission is to increase literacy levels through effective and sustainable community collaboration and engagement. It works with educators, business and labor leaders, philanthropies, civic and faith-based groups, policymakers, literacy providers and students to demonstrate that everyone thrives when a community is committed to 100% literacy.
Proliteracy
ProLiteracy champions the power of literacy to improve the lives of adults and their families, communities, and societies, envisioning a world in which everyone can read, write, compute, and use technology to lead healthy, productive, and fulfilling lives.
Texas Center for the Advancement of Literacy and Learning
TCALL is a Center of the College of Education and Human Development at Texas A&M University with the mission to provide a centralized resource for collaborative networking, knowledge, and service for those meeting the literacy needs of adult learners and their families .
The Campaign for Grade-level Reading
The Campaign is a collaborative effort by dozens of funders across the nation to: close the gap in reading achievement that separates many low-income students from their peers; raise the bar for reading proficiency so that all students are assessed by world-class standards; and ensure that all children, including and especially children from low-income families, have an equitable opportunity to meet those higher standards.
